Senior Tax Manager
About the job Senior Tax Manager
A large consulting firm is currently seeking a Senior Tax Manager to join a growing practice in Los Angeles.
Responsibilities:
- Manage a portfolio of real estate clients of varying size and scope and act as the point of contact for internal and external clients; build and handle client relationships by advising them and being responsible for delivering high quality tax service and advice
- Work as part of a cross-functional account team for your clients that may cross audit, tax and advisory; manage and empower teams of tax professionals/assistants working on client projects
- Oversee financial performance of your client engagements including billing, collections, and the budget for projects
- Advise clients and be responsible for delivering high quality tax service and advice
- Participate in and contribute to market and business activities supporting High Growth Sectors
Additional Responsibilities for Senior Manager:
- Manage risk for the firm and their clients by understanding the technical tax aspects of various reporting positions
Qualifications:
- Minimum five years of recent experience as a tax manager with a public accounting firm; partnership tax experience in the financial services industry specific to real estate and real estate private equity funds
- Bachelor's degree from an accredited college/university; licensed CPA, JD/LLM or EA, in addition to others on the firm's approved credential listing; any individual who does not possess at least one of the approved designations/credentials when their employment commences, has one year from their date of hire to obtain at least one of the approved designations/credentials; should you like to see the complete list of currently approved designations/credentials for the hiring practice/service line, we can provide you with that list
- Proficiency in the taxation of REITs, partnerships, and other flow-through entities
- Exceptional skills in reviewing 1120-REIT and 1065 tax returns, including complex partner allocations
- Excellent research and writing skills; applied working knowledge of REIT and partnership tax regulations and ASC 740
- Strong verbal and written communication skills with the ability to articulate complex financial information and experience managing multiple client engagements and client service teams
Additional Qualifications for Senior Manager:
- minimum eight years recent experience as a tax manager with a public accounting firm; partnership tax experience in the financial services industry specific to real estate and real estate private equity funds
